Hi,
Can't help you on the JDM units, but I desperately need advice on how to remove the stock headlight assembly on the passenger side. It appears that you need to remove the bumper first, but in order to remove the bumper, you need to get at the fasteners underneath the headlight assembly. It seems like a "catch 22" situation. If you could give me any advice on how to get the headlight assembly off would be greatly appreciated.
Thanks, Ming
You will have to remove the bumper. There are four bolts that hold it on. One is hidden behind each turn signal on the bumper, the other two are behind the headlights underneath the battery on one side and the other is under the alternater. Once you take those out, which can be a slight bitch without lots of extensions, you remove the bumper by pulling it straight out and then there are like 4 or 5 bolts that hold the headlight assembly in. its been a while since i did it but i believe there are two underneath the light, one on the side under the corner light, adn one (maybe two) on top. Then you have to unplug them..
